ANO "Together for a Strong Country" held a practical master class "Practical cases in foreign economic activity" at the RANEPA under the President of the Russian Federation

On May 25, the ANO "Together for a Strong Country" together with the Association of Copyright Holders, Licensees, Importers and Distributors "BASIS" held a practical master class "Practical cases in foreign economic activity" at the RANEPA under the President of the Russian Federation.

The event was attended by students of the Faculty of Customs Affairs of the Institute of Law and National Security of the Presidential Academy, for whom experts and business representatives prepared a series of practice-oriented cases based on real situations in the field of foreign economic activity, customs regulation and intellectual property protection.

During the master class, the participants discussed:

  • mechanisms to protect consumers from counterfeit products;
  • interaction of copyright holders with regulatory authorities;
  • peculiarities of identification of imaginary transactions in customs practice;
  • current tools for Russian companies to enter the Chinese market;
  • key terms of foreign trade contracts and practical recommendations from experts.

The students were particularly interested in practical tasks and analysis of real-life cases, allowing them to see how theoretical knowledge is applied in professional activities.

Following the event, Igor Valeryevich Sergeev, Dean of the Faculty of Customs Affairs of the RANEPA Institute of National Security and National Research, stressed the importance of cooperation between educational institutions and the professional community for training future specialists in the field of customs and foreign economic activity.
